外部JavaScriptファイル(.jsファイル)を別のサーバーから呼び出してもらって、常に最新の情報を届けるというアイデアは面白いと思うんだけど、これってXSS(クロスサイトスクリプティング)の危険性もあるから、信頼してもらえるサイトのサービスじゃないと使ってもらえないなぁ。
用意する外部JavaScriptファイルの中では、単にdocument.write()によってHTMLを書き出すだけにしておくと古いブラウザにも対応できて汎用的。それに表示速度も速いし。実は最初はこのことに気付かず、思いっきりオブジェクト指向で書いたコードを用意してみたけどNetscape Navigator 4.0などで読み込んでみると表示にかなり時間がかかった。
ちなみに利用する側からの呼び出し方法は、HTMLファイルの中で(外部JavaScriptファイルによる情報を)表示したいところに
<script src=http://domain.com/hoge.js></script>
などと書くだけでよくて、とても簡単。
この話は少し前から聞いていたけど、将来的には電話の通話料は(基本料金以外は)無料の方向に進んでいくのかな。
例えば、3.33MバイトのJPEGファイルをZIP圧縮した場合、約3.31Mバイト程度にしかならないものが、超縮(quf)では、約114Kバイトまで圧縮できたとしている(同社調べ)。
ええッ。そんなに圧縮できるのかなぁ。